Idea for small garden pocket. Something simple and without symmetry.
Lights: Brilliant W, RGB and RGB+W
Irrigation: Gardena with pressure control, moisture sensor and use of 3 channels
Plants: Mondo grass dwarf
Fountain: Udara
Power point: outdoor smart connected to Grid
Nothing special in tools. Irrigation tools (pipe cutter and heat gun). Usual soil gardening tools ( shovel and rack)
Set up ground as you like. Compress the soil
Put edge to separate soil and gravel
Cover the soil with weed matt. Put Pillar white tarp to separate soil from hravel
Set up irrigation and lights
Plant grass
Set up the fountain
Use apps from Gris and Brilliant to set up.up timing for lights and fountain
